Job Description

Job Title:   Training Controller - Site

Organisation: Nile Breweries Limited

Duty Station: Jinja, Uganda


The key purpose is to focus on shop floor capability by supporting the SKAP process across the zone. This includes evaluating training effectiveness to ensure financial and time benefits. The role also supports Line and VPO in driving methods aligned with the VPO strategy and ensures efficient administration and planning of L&D interventions, from annual LNA processes to budget development and applying the 70/20/10 principle across all plants.

Duties, Roles and Responsibilities

  • Initiate the training and development process

  • Get relevant input for training buckets, this is taken from Team room discussions, ITF, Annual Training Plan and all other problem-solving discussion (i.e.5Why’s, abnormality reports, walk abouts)

  • Collaborate with People Manager and BOP Training Specialist regarding activities on site

  • Engage with L&D Specialist regarding suitable solutions where the training solution does not exist/not part of the Annual Training Calendar

  • Consolidate departmental training needs by reviewing L&D inputs e.g., PDP as input to the annual LNA / budgeting process

  • Prepare for training

  • Coordinate the logistics of the required training and ensure relevant candidates are present and available

  • Request Purchase Order requests from the NOCC L&D Services team for external training as per the signed off LNA

  • Obtain approval from Zone L&D Specialist for costs not included in the LNA

  • Implement the learning process Effective use of SOP’s

  • Execution of the SOP’s are relevant and effective, use the as training aid), track and check whether people are people being trained against SOP, identify gaps in SOP and ensure Line Manager updates the SOP document)

  • Draw on the expertise of SME’s to run learning programmes

  • Ensure all training completed is captured in Training Bucket and registers are completed

  • Ensure all training registers and events are recorded via NOCC L&D Services

  • Adapt training programme to meet the needs of the team / plant / audience i.e. run 2-day programme over a two-week period with short intervals

  • Conducts a quality assurance of Visual Boards by engaging with Line Managers / HOD’s

  • Evaluate the effectiveness of training and develop ROI report

  • Complete the Level 1 evaluations for formal classroom training, analyse the results and develop actions that will improve training effectiveness

  • Monitor and Support SKAP

  • Assist Line Manager to develop annual SKAP plan for team

  • Monitor weekly / monthly adherence to plan

  • Support Line Manager to schedule formative and summative assessments

  • Identify SME Assessors and ensure an adequate pool of assessors in the plant

  • Administration of SKAP Management system by ensuring information is accurate (Line Manager captures the assessment result, TC quality assures)

  • Identify Training Solutions for future Pipeline

  • Trainees: Conduct monthly check in with trainee to identify opportunities for trainee to attend training as per the planned training bucket (Line Manager responsible to report on progress, driving the trainee programme progress)

  • Reporting

  • Ensure the relevant KPI’s are reported against weekly and monthly routines

  • Communicate and share with relevant stakeholders on site

  • VPO Support

  • Participation in Pillar meetings where applicable

  • KPI / PI cascade to the shopfloor

  • Ensure SDCA compliance

  • Attend and support problem solving initiatives by identifying coaching opportunities and training gaps

  • Assist and support teams through the facilitation of the cascading of the department strategy and KPI/PI’s

  • Develop agenda and schedule VPO training sessions for dept/site

  • VPO Routines

  • Post training provide the necessary coaching to Operators and Front Line Managers

  • Facilitate and assist in ATO and develop ATO boards where qualified to do so

  • Coach level 1 teams on effective problem solving techniques (5Why, Abnormality Report, ITF)

  • Plan OWD’s against SOP’s

  • Conduct OWD’s where qualified to do so

  • Ensure that the development of SOP’s by subject matter experts are continuously completed as per the VPO requirements and SOP’s SWI’s development process

  • Coach and train Level 1 employees against new and current SOP’s where the TC is a subject matter expert

  • Ensure Training support for VPO team day out by coaching L&D related items

  • Coaching and evaluation of visual management boards utilisation

  • Audit and health check OWS and AWS

  • Attend daily, weekly and monthly meetings as per MCRS

  • Attend PCM meeting where required

  • Support the Implementing of Autonomous Teams process

  • Track and monitor MCLs and SCLs

  • Coaching on People and Management Pillar Block and Tools

  • Coach shop Frontline by using documented business description and process maps

  • ATO (Preparedness, Implementation, Team Empowerment, Tools to complete ATO)

Qualifications, Education and Competencies

  • Min – BSc/HND in Engineering or related discipline

  • 3-5 years in a Brewery environment Knowledge of Performance management, L& D and SKAP practices including the evaluation of training

  • Key Attributes and Competencies:

  • Deep technical knowledge

  • Knowledge of VPO principles

  • Proven training and facilitation skills

  • Proactive, independent and high initiative

  • Attention to detail

  • Methodical record keeper

  • Ability to work effectively in teams

  • Good communicator

  • Positive attitude with high energy levels.

  • Self-motivated with strong self-management bias.

  • Team player with ability to influence and communicate at all levels of the

  • Ability to work under pressure, yet maintaining high attention to detail

  • Ability to operate independently, demonstrate initiative, sound judgment, sensitivity and maintain good business acumen with a professional approach

  • Good interpersonal skills
